Title: The Conceptual Development of Exponential Relationships in a Class for Prospective Teachers
Abstract: Prospective teachers need deep conceptual understanding of the content they will teach to be effective in their future classrooms. In order to support the development of this type of knowledge, we need to understand the learning process as it occurs in classroom environments. Traditionally, research on learning has focused on either the development of a few individuals taught in a small group setting or on the mathematical progress of a classroom collective. While both have contributed to our understanding, neither help us understand what individuals learn when participating in a class. In this study, I documented the mathematical progress of the classroom collective and explored relationships between that progress and the nature of individual students’ subsequent reasoning.
